Grade 1 and Grade 8 applicants will start to receive offers from 30th May. Grade 1 and Grade 8 applicants will start to receive offers from 30th May.

The Western Cape Education Department reminds parents to be on the look out for offers from schools starting this week.Be sure to check that your contact details on file with WCED are correct and that you can access the online application portal.

The Western Cape Education Department says that parents who applied should make sure their contact details are correct and that they are able to“If a parent has not confirmed their choice by 14 June 2024, the system will automatically confirm their top-ranked choice of school that has made an offer.

“We will leave no stone unturned in our efforts to place every learner whose parents applied on time as quickly as possible,” the Western Cape Education Department said in a statement. Parents who don’t respond by 14th June will see their child placed into the top-ranked school which made an offer.
